STAFF REPORT <br />DATE: August 7th 2024 <br />CONSENT <br />AGENDA ITEM: Approve Landscape Security Reduction for Hidden Meadows Development SUBMITTED BY: Sophia Jensen, City Planner <br />ISSUE BEFORE COUNCIL: Should the City Council approve release of warranty security for landscaping for Hidden Meadows phase 1 and 2? <br />PROPOSAL DETAILS/ANALYSIS: Staff has received and processed requests to reduce the development security for landscaping improvements for the Hidden Meadows Development. These phases were inspected and accepted by the Landscape Architect on 7/12/2024. <br /> Current Security Amount Proposed Security Amount <br />$57,813 $01.Hidden Meadows (Phase 1 and 2) <br />FISCAL IMPACT: It is the City’s goal to retain, at all times during the subdivision improvements, a security amount that is adequate to ensure completion of all elements of the improvements as protection to the City tax payers against the potential of developer default. <br />RECOMMENDATION: Staff is recommending that the City Council, as part of the Consent Agenda, approve the security reductions for the Hidden Meadows development. The release of security is <br />contingent on the developer being current with all other payments and obligations in accordance with the Development Agreement, including a positive escrow balance as required by the city. If removed from the consent agenda, the recommended motion for the action is as follows: <br />“Move to approve the security release for the Hidden Meadows 1st and 2nd additions as detailed in the respective Security Reduction Worksheets, contingent on the developer being current with all other payments and obligations in accordance with the Development Agreement, including a positive escrow balance as required by the city” <br />ATTACHMENTS: <br />1.Security Reduction Worksheets2.Close Out Inspection Letters (Phase 1 and 2)
